Abstract
A charging member for charging a member to be charged includes: an electrically conductive member to which a voltage is applicable; and a coating layer that coats the electrically conductive member, in which when a d.c. voltage of |10| to |300| (V) is applied to the electrically conductive member, the following relationship is satisfied: Z/Ra is 0.7 or less, where Z is the standard deviation of a resistance of the charging member, and Ra is an average value of the resistance of the charging member.
